Kwamanzi, a documentary drama researched by Nicholas Ellenbogen and the Loft Theatre Company for the specific purpose of educating an audience through entertainment. Centred around the drought cycle, Kwamanzi deals with man's intrusion into the eco-system and his effect on it. Performed in the Monument Theatre at the National Arts Festival, 1985, starring Greg Mellvill-Smith, Annie Robinson, Ellis Pearson and Judi Broderick among others.
